At Hononegah's August Board of Education meeting, Student Council representative Riley Dick talked about the activities planned for Homecoming 2022. Hononegah Community High School is celebrating 100 years and Homecoming events will be a reflection of those years.

Events and activities will include:

  • Window painting on Sept. 17
  • Lip- sync battle on Sept. 19
  • Talent show on Sept. 20
  • Powderpuff games, a pep rally and a bonfire on Sept. 22
  • Parade on Sept. 23, followed by the Homecoming football game
  • Homecoming dance on Sept. 24

The Rockton Fire Department will oversee the bonfire. 

The parade will roll down Rockton's Main Street on Friday evening, Sept. 23, followed by the Homecoming football game.  The final event of that week is the Homecoming dance on Saturday evening, Sept. 24. As a nice bonus, plans are to have food trucks during the Powderpuff games. Alumni may enter Friday night's game at no charge and an alumni tent will be found in the end zone. Tickets are available on Hononegah High School's website for the H.O.P.E Foundation's Feast on the Field Tailgate party.

Adding to Homecoming spirit, the council is creating a "heavy metal" T-shirt concept for Spirit Week. The shirt hopes to feature upcoming school events on the back of the shirt, as if they were tour dates, and the name “Hononegah” prominently displayed on the front in “Metallica” style lettering.
